ขนาดวิดีโอ: 1280 X 720853 X 480640 X 360
แสดงแผงควบคุมโปรแกรมเล่น
เล่นอัตโนมัติ
เล่นใหม่
[言い間違い]1:43 のところで1000+200ってしゃべってますが、正しくは1000+2000です💦
ネスト深くなっちゃうわぁ。と思いながら見ていると。「疲れているときにコードを書かない。」めっちゃわかります。夜中の疲れているときってどこからともなくやってきたこびとさんが一仕事してくれるんですよね。すげーやっつけ仕事ですけどね。
ご視聴いただきありがとうございます😊やっつけ仕事のこびとさんがコードを書かないよう、時には「明日にしよう!」って割り切りも大切ですよね!
とても役に立つ動画だったので101回高評価ボタンを押しときました
😂 高評価ありがとうございます!!
とても参考になりました。私も疲れている時はコードを書かなかったり、勉強もしません。そのため1日の作業量や勉強量は計画的に進めています。
疲れているとモチベーションも成果もなかなか出ないですよね😵 計画的に進めているのはすごいです!!
50本おめでとうございます。半分も見ていないかも〜。初心者なのでわからないとこもあるのですが、後で役に立つことがあります。
ありがとうございます!沢山動画があるので、興味がわくものからピックアップしながら見てもらえたら嬉しいです😊
副作用だけで構成された関数を大量に書きまくってました・・・特にクラスのメソッドで、メンバ変数を更新するだけでreturnしないようなコード
ややこしいのですが、クラスのメソッドの場合は「メンバ変数なら変更してOK」という流派もあります。この辺はスタイルの問題で「メンバ変数でも変更NG」という流派もあります😵メンバ変数の変更については意見が割れる部分ですが、それでも関数(メソッドではない)の副作用があるコードは良くない、って認識は多くの人に賛同してもらえると思います!
@@pythonvtuber9917 複雑なんですね・・・普通の関数では副作用を出すのは良くないというのは分かったので、意識してみますいつも自己流で書いて動いて喜んでるだけで成長がないので、この動画は参考になりました!
ありがたいです
関数使うクセがついてないものだから、ネストが深くなってしまうんですよね。多次元配列の関わるループ処理をしようとすると、どこで入れたらいいのかわからなくてなおさらネストが深くなってしまって。こういった場合ではどこで関数を入れるのか、判断のコツみたいなのありますか?
たぶん全部やってます^^;他人が見てもわかりやすいコード、つまり後で自分が見てもわかりやすいコードを書けるようにと思いました。
コメントありがとうございます😊分かりやすいコードが書けるようになると、バグも少なくなるし、自分の為にも他人の為にもなるので、日々心がけたいですね!
ifの中にforが入るコードってあまり見たことがないんですが、なんでなんでしょう?
コメントの書き方もいろいろありますね。コード修正して、コメントがあって無い場合もあります。逆にコメントがなくて、コードが読めないなら、いじるな!って文化もありますね。レガシーコードです、年季入って、簡単に変更できないとかね。ちょっと話変わりますが、Pythonの安定バージョンって何かありますか?Windowsで3.11を、ファイルオープンして書き込むと例外が発生します。Macや*BSDでは問題なく動くのに・・
コメント、ご質問ありがとうございます😊Pythonの安定バージョンですが、LTSみたいなものはありませんが、3桁目が大きい値のバージョンがbugfixを重ねているバージョンなので、安定していて良いかと思います。なので、今現在の比較的新しくて安定しているバージョンだと3.9.10とかですかね。3.10でもまだ3.10.2までしか出てないので...😵
@@pythonvtuber9917 なるほど、そのようなバージョンの付け方なんですね。ちなみに愛用してるバージョンはどれでしょうか?最新がいいと思い、3.11を使ってみたら、ファイルをオープンしてライトするだけなのに、例外で動かなかったです。Windows版は動かなく、Mac版は動く、なので安定バージョンを知りたいんですよね。
Pythonのバージョンは更新され続けるので、固定で使っているバージョンはないですね...2022年2月現在であれば、私なら3.9系を使いますね!
50本目おめでとうございます。サプーさんの動画はとても分かりやすく、いつも楽しく拝見しています^_^これからも応援してます📣
ありがとうございます😆1本1本、頑張って作っているので、そう言っていただけてとっても嬉しいです!!これからもよろしくお願いします😊
まだ python に慣れていないから、コメントアウトを多め長めに書いていますが、確かに書きすぎると逆にごちゃごちゃになるの分かります。。。python は cobol や Fortran のような変数宣言らしい変数宣言がないので、どこで何を宣言したのかが分かるようにめっちゃコメントアウトしてしまう癖がありますw
ご視聴いただきありがとうございます😊Pythonでは変数は基本的に使用するそのタイミングで生成するので、コードの先頭で変数宣言する言語を使っていた場合は、ちょっと慣れが必要かもですね😵
おめでとうございます。実際コード書いて、コメント多すぎて、もっとスッキリ出来ないかな?って思います(^^)
ありがとうございます😊コメントは多くても邪魔だし、少ないと分かりにくくなるので、調整が難しいですよね💦
最後のやつめっちゃ自分のこと言ってる。コメントの量は自分は大体5~6行間隔で書いてますね。適量かなぁ?めんどくさくて書いてないこと多いけど。(基本的に趣味での範囲でやってるし、作ったら見返す事なんてほぼない)ネストを深くしないってなぁ。ネストを深くしないようにすると行数が多くなりそうだしなぁ。難しい。(なんて事もある)
コメントありがとうございます!チーム開発においては読みやすさは重要ですが、趣味の範囲で自分しか見ないしそもそも見返すことがないのであれば、特に気にしなくていいかもですね!
[言い間違い]
1:43 のところで1000+200ってしゃべってますが、正しくは1000+2000です💦
ネスト深くなっちゃうわぁ。と思いながら見ていると。「疲れているときにコードを書かない。」めっちゃわかります。夜中の疲れているときってどこからともなくやってきたこびとさんが一仕事してくれるんですよね。すげーやっつけ仕事ですけどね。
ご視聴いただきありがとうございます😊
やっつけ仕事のこびとさんがコードを書かないよう、時には「明日にしよう!」って割り切りも大切ですよね!
とても役に立つ動画だったので101回高評価ボタンを押しときました
😂 高評価ありがとうございます!!
とても参考になりました。私も疲れている時はコードを書かなかったり、勉強もしません。そのため1日の作業量や勉強量は計画的に進めています。
疲れているとモチベーションも成果もなかなか出ないですよね😵 計画的に進めているのはすごいです!!
50本おめでとうございます。半分も見ていないかも〜。
初心者なのでわからないとこもあるのですが、後で役に立つことがあります。
ありがとうございます!
沢山動画があるので、興味がわくものからピックアップしながら見てもらえたら嬉しいです😊
副作用だけで構成された関数を大量に書きまくってました・・・
特にクラスのメソッドで、メンバ変数を更新するだけでreturnしないようなコード
ややこしいのですが、クラスのメソッドの場合は「メンバ変数なら変更してOK」という流派もあります。この辺はスタイルの問題で「メンバ変数でも変更NG」という流派もあります😵
メンバ変数の変更については意見が割れる部分ですが、それでも関数(メソッドではない)の副作用があるコードは良くない、って認識は多くの人に賛同してもらえると思います!
@@pythonvtuber9917
複雑なんですね・・・
普通の関数では副作用を出すのは良くないというのは分かったので、意識してみます
いつも自己流で書いて動いて喜んでるだけで成長がないので、この動画は参考になりました!
ありがたいです
関数使うクセがついてないものだから、ネストが深くなってしまうんですよね。
多次元配列の関わるループ処理をしようとすると、どこで入れたらいいのかわからなくてなおさらネストが深くなってしまって。
こういった場合ではどこで関数を入れるのか、判断のコツみたいなのありますか?
たぶん全部やってます^^;
他人が見てもわかりやすいコード、つまり後で自分が見てもわかりやすいコードを書けるようにと思いました。
コメントありがとうございます😊
分かりやすいコードが書けるようになると、バグも少なくなるし、自分の為にも他人の為にもなるので、日々心がけたいですね!
ifの中にforが入るコードってあまり見たことがないんですが、なんでなんでしょう?
コメントの書き方もいろいろありますね。
コード修正して、コメントがあって無い場合もあります。
逆にコメントがなくて、
コードが読めないなら、いじるな!って文化もありますね。
レガシーコードです、年季入って、簡単に変更できないとかね。
ちょっと話変わりますが、Pythonの安定バージョンって何かありますか?
Windowsで3.11を、ファイルオープンして書き込むと例外が発生します。
Macや*BSDでは問題なく動くのに・・
コメント、ご質問ありがとうございます😊
Pythonの安定バージョンですが、LTSみたいなものはありませんが、3桁目が大きい値のバージョンがbugfixを重ねているバージョンなので、安定していて良いかと思います。なので、今現在の比較的新しくて安定しているバージョンだと3.9.10とかですかね。3.10でもまだ3.10.2までしか出てないので...😵
@@pythonvtuber9917 なるほど、そのようなバージョンの付け方なんですね。ちなみに愛用してるバージョンはどれでしょうか?最新がいいと思い、3.11を使ってみたら、ファイルをオープンしてライトするだけなのに、例外で動かなかったです。Windows版は動かなく、Mac版は動く、なので安定バージョンを知りたいんですよね。
Pythonのバージョンは更新され続けるので、固定で使っているバージョンはないですね...
2022年2月現在であれば、私なら3.9系を使いますね!
50本目おめでとうございます。
サプーさんの動画はとても分かりやすく、いつも楽しく拝見しています^_^これからも応援してます📣
ありがとうございます😆1本1本、頑張って作っているので、そう言っていただけてとっても嬉しいです!!
これからもよろしくお願いします😊
まだ python に慣れていないから、コメントアウトを多め長めに書いていますが、確かに書きすぎると逆にごちゃごちゃに
なるの分かります。。。python は cobol や Fortran のような変数宣言らしい変数宣言がないので、どこで何を宣言したのかが分かるようにめっちゃコメントアウトしてしまう癖がありますw
ご視聴いただきありがとうございます😊
Pythonでは変数は基本的に使用するそのタイミングで生成するので、コードの先頭で変数宣言する言語を使っていた場合は、ちょっと慣れが必要かもですね😵
おめでとうございます。
実際コード書いて、コメント多すぎて、もっとスッキリ出来ないかな?って思います(^^)
ありがとうございます😊
コメントは多くても邪魔だし、少ないと分かりにくくなるので、調整が難しいですよね💦
最後のやつめっちゃ自分のこと言ってる。
コメントの量は自分は大体5~6行間隔で書いてますね。適量かなぁ?
めんどくさくて書いてないこと多いけど。(基本的に趣味での範囲でやってるし、作ったら見返す事なんてほぼない)
ネストを深くしないってなぁ。ネストを深くしないようにすると行数が多くなりそうだしなぁ。難しい。(なんて事もある)
コメントありがとうございます!
チーム開発においては読みやすさは重要ですが、趣味の範囲で自分しか見ないしそもそも見返すことがないのであれば、特に気にしなくていいかもですね!